Technical Context
This IGBT employs Infineon's TRENCHSTOP™ 5 technology with field-stop layer and optimized carrier lifetime control to achieve low conduction and switching losses simultaneously. It features a positive temperature coefficient for VCE(sat), enabling stable paralleling without current-sharing resistors.
The device integrates an ultrafast soft-recovery anti-parallel diode with reverse recovery charge Qrr = 3.9 µC and peak reverse recovery current IRRM = 72 A at Tj = 150 °C, reducing voltage overshoot during turn-off commutation.

Pinout & Package
IRG7PH42UDPBF is housed in a TO-247AC package with isolated tab, featuring three terminals: Collector (C), Gate (G), and Emitter (E). The metal tab is electrically connected to the collector, requiring insulating mounting hardware in most applications.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| Collector (C) | Main power output terminal | Connected to high-side DC bus or motor phase; carries full load current and must be routed with low-inductance layout. |
| Gate (G) | Control input | Receives PWM signal; requires gate driver capable of ±20 V rating and ≥2 A peak drive current for fast switching. |
| Emitter (E) | Power return and reference node | Serves as common reference for gate drive and current sensing; layout must minimize stray inductance to prevent voltage spikes. |

FAQ
What gate resistor value is recommended for IRG7PH42UDPBF in a 16 kHz motor drive application?
A gate resistor of 10 Ω (non-inductive) is recommended to limit peak gate current to ~2 A while achieving ~250 ns turn-on and ~350 ns turn-off delays. This balances switching loss reduction against EMI control and gate driver stress. Layout parasitics must be minimized to avoid oscillation, especially on the gate loop.
Does IRG7PH42UDPBF require negative gate voltage for reliable turn-off?
No. IRG7PH42UDPBF is fully specified for 0 V to +15 V gate drive with no requirement for negative bias. However, applying –5 V to –8 V during off-state improves noise immunity and prevents spurious turn-on in high-dV/dt environments such as multi-level inverters or high-frequency SiC co-designs.
Can IRG7PH42UDPBF be paralleled without emitter resistors?
Yes-its positive VCE(sat) temperature coefficient ensures natural current sharing across parallel devices. Thermal coupling between dies must be uniform (e.g., shared heatsink with identical mounting pressure), and gate drive paths must be symmetrical to avoid dynamic imbalance. No emitter degeneration resistors are needed.
What is the maximum allowable case temperature for continuous operation?
The maximum continuous case temperature is 100 °C, corresponding to 42 A rated collector current. Operation above this requires derating per the datasheet's IC vs. Tc curve. At Tc = 80 °C, maximum continuous IC rises to 58 A; at Tc = 110 °C, it drops to 35 A.
